Event Description:
Join us for an educational event at the chamber during your lunchtime and enhance your marketing skills through our "Marketing Mapping" workshop.
Is your marketing working? Business owners consistently rate marketing as a top source of stress. The Marketing Map is a hands-on procedural tool that will help you streamline your marketing, identify weak points, and improve the way you acquire new business. We'll share cutting-edge marketing strategy and help you build out your customer pipeline. Join us, take the stress out of your marketing, and grow!
Free to attend, and it will be hosted in the chamber conference room. Brown bag it if you'd like to.
•Led by David Ramirez•
David is the Executive Director of Marketing and Communications at San Japan. San Japan’s flagship convention annually bring over 18,000 visitors to downtown San Antonio and thousands more to “off-season” events throughout the city.  He is the Manager of Learning at Scaleworks, a technology firm bringing innovative cloud-based companies to the Alamo City. David is a guest marketing instructor at the UTSA Small Business Development Center, a mentor at Break Fast and Launch (San Antonio’s Culinary Business Accelerator), a committee lead at San Antonio Startup Week, marketing consultant at Alamo Kitchens (a culinary co-working space), and member of Geekdom.
